Unlike many film industries where slang is standardised, Malayalam cinema celebrates dialectical diversity. A fisherman from Kochi speaks a rapid, verb-less form of Malayalam that is nearly incomprehensible to a farmer from Kasargod . Films like Ee.Ma.Yau. (2018) are lexicons of local dialect, where the comedy and tragedy emerge from the specific way people mispronounce Latin words or mangle English.

If there is one area where Malayalam cinema has both reflected and led cultural change, it is in the portrayal of its women. For decades, the "ideal" Keralite woman on screen was a revisionist construct—clad in the kasavu mundu (traditional off-white saree with gold border), soft-spoken, and sacrificial. This was a stark contrast to the reality of Keralite women, who, historically, enjoyed a relatively better status due to matrilineal systems (among Nairs and some other communities) and high female literacy.
The 1980s saw films like Mukhamukham (Face to Face) and Kodiyettam (The Ascent) featuring complex, sexually aware women. But it was in the 2010s that the rupture became explicit. Take Off (2017) presented a female nurse as a resilient, strategic leader, not a damsel. The Great Indian Kitchen (2021) became a cultural bombshell, dismantling the patriarchy of the Keralite household frame by frame—showing the physical toll of making dosa batter daily, the segregation of dining spaces, and the ritual pollution of menstruation. It wasn't just a film; it was a political manifesto that led to real-world conversations about domestic labour and temple entry.
